My plan for injections and dosage this week is a 7.5mg dose injection at lunchtime.

Weight loss:  200g

Last week:  60.6kg, this week 60.4kg

Total loss:  11kg (around 24lbs, or 1 stone 10lbs)

That’s an average loss of 1.2lbs a week, which I’m very happy with.
